How To Read An Eeg. (1) obtain the age of the patient, (2) identify the state of the patient (awake, drowsy, asleep), and (3) identify what montage you are using (average, referential, bipolar). Web an electroencephalogram (eeg) is a test that measures electrical activity in the brain using small, metal discs (electrodes) attached to the scalp.
